Qualifications Required 3+ years of experience in eDiscovery, information governance, compliance operations, privacy operations, or a related field Hands-on experience supporting or administering Microsoft Purview Familiarity with regulatory and best practice frameworks GDPR, TRAIGA andNIST CSF, NIST
Privacy Framework and NIST Risk Management Framework (RMF) Familiarity with GRC best practices (Controls Management, Risk Management, Policy Management, Third-Party Risk Management) Familiarity with the eDiscovery lifecycle and litigation holds. Experience with Microsoft 365 (SharePoint, Teams), Box, and similar platforms Strong documentation, organization, and cross-functional communication skills Ability to work independently while continuing to develop new skills. Preferred Certified E-Discovery Specialist (CEDS) or similar certification Exposure to governance, risk, or compliance programs and CRISC certification Experience supporting audits or regulatory requirements. Reporting Line Reports to the Governance, Risk, and Compliance Manager and partners with Legal, Risk, Integration Managers, and Infrastructure teams.
